Ooh that brings back memories....    of setting my 500 on fire! I tried those carbs on my 500, it fired up great and blipping the throttle had it sounding awesome, really fierce sounding, like my 500 had never sounded before, then it spat back through the carbs and burst into flames in the middle of my (attached to my house) garage full of my other bikes. I managed to put the fire out using the garden hose but wrecked the bike, wiring harness wrecked, side panels melted, seat gone, frame scorched, fuel tank full of petrol near boiling point, among much other damage.

I don't do the lottery coz I keep using up all my luck, how it didn't end a lot more serious was pure luck, still got the bike, love it to bits with its original carbs ::)

Tuned/jetted right it would be awesome.
